Thanks to the help of our incredible volunteers, UQ Sustainability and UQ Property and Facilities, the Society for Conservation Biology UQ Brisbane Chapter planted 10,000 trees along the campus riverbank in 2015. This restoration project aimed to provide understory habitat for small birds and the endangered Richmond Birdwing Butterfly.
